A visit to a natural history museum proves catastrophic for two high school rivals, an overachiever and a jock, when an ancient Aztec statue casts a spell that causes them to switch bodies and see exactly what it's like to walk in the other's shoes.

I know I should say that this was the worst movie ever.However I was surprised I actually liked the movie. Not as good as She's the man, but pretty enjoyable. After a visit to museum, enemies find themselves in each other bodies. Girl in boy's, and boy in girl's. What what follows is struggles with every day life and of course prom.The plot was interesting and of course there is a "hidden" message that you should try to understand people before judging. The acting wasn't the best there is, but I've seen much worse. There were actually moments, when the main actors did their job well.Of course, when enemies first, you know what they will be at the end. But for some odd reason even that didn't bother me. I was prepared to hate and despise this movie, but to my surprise it was funny and entertaining. Not sure I would watch it again, but for one time thing it was okay and didn't feel waste of time.

It seems everywhere you look nowadays there's a "feel good body swap comedy" creeping out of the woodwork, and this one is no exception.It's the age old story, Boy meets Girl, Girl and Boy hate each other, Boy and Girl switch bodies thanks to some mystical mumbo jumbo the writers can't be bothered to explain, and then Girl and Boy fall hopelessly in love while figuring out their "Hilarious" predicament.Actually, this light hearted tale isn't too bad. and the gorgeous but under rated Samaire Armstrong is easy on the eyes, while the sound track is a delight to the ears. But sadly the story is crammed full of under developed background characters who never really get a chance to tell their side of things.Needless to say, just like every other movie of this kind, everything is neatly resolved at the end to everyone's relief, But it's a sweet addition to the genre none the less.
